Multi-station plane type extrusion oil cylinder
Technical Field
The utility model relates to a used multistation plane extrusion hydro-cylinder of die casting technology.
Background
In the die casting process, due to the non-uniformity of die casting products, air holes are inevitably generated when aluminum water is injected into a die to influence the quality of die castings, so that the air holes are usually eliminated by adopting an extrusion oil cylinder in the die casting process, but due to the irregularity of the die, a plurality of air holes can be formed on one plane, a good effect cannot be achieved by adopting a single extrusion oil cylinder, and in addition, due to the limited internal space of the die, a plurality of required extrusion oil cylinders are inconvenient to be installed in the die at one time.

The multi-station planar extrusion oil cylinder shown in the figures 1 and 2 is provided with a connecting plate 1, three small oil cylinders 2 with different cylinder diameters are mounted on the connecting plate 1, the axes of the three small oil cylinders 2 are parallel to each other, each small oil cylinder 2 is provided with a cylinder barrel 2-1, a piston 2-2 in sliding fit with the inner wall of the cylinder barrel 2-1, a piston rod 2-3 fixedly connected with the piston 2-2 and an end cover 2-4 fixed at the front end of the cylinder barrel 2-1, oil ports are correspondingly formed in the cylinder barrel 2-1, and a guide sleeve 2-5 is arranged between the end cover 2-4 and the piston rod 2-3.
The connecting plate 1 is positioned in front of the end cover 2-4, and a connecting bolt in threaded connection with the connecting plate 1 penetrates through the rear end of the cylinder barrel 2-1.
The utility model discloses a connecting plate 1 makes up into an organic whole with the little hydro-cylinder 2 of three different cylinder diameters, constitutes an extrusion hydro-cylinder that accords with the special space requirement of die casting die, and three little hydro-cylinder 2 mutually noninterferes can independently carry out reciprocating motion separately, also can the simultaneous movement, realizes under the limited situation in mould space, accomplishes the extrusion to the different position gas pockets of die casting jointly, improves the die casting quality.
